The Vegetarian Society is the oldest vegetarian organisation in the world. As a registered charity it offers an independent voice to promote and provide information on vegetarianism. The Society operates its own V symbol trademark, The Cordon Vert Cookery School, a membership scheme and publishes The Vegetarian magazine quarterly. The Society is dedicated to promoting a diet that is good for animals, health and the environment.
